Bit of a Bio:
As a proud, Maine elementary teacher for over 30 years and three years as an eLearning coach, I am a passionate educator that brings knowledge, energy and positivity to any learning setting. I hold a Master's in Literacy and a Bachelor's in Elementary Education from the University of Maine, Orono. My background spans grades K-5, multi-age and remote instruction, instructional design, mentoring, and leadership. I am dedicated to literacy, math, technology integration, and collaborative teaching practices. My commitment to education has been recognized with honors such as a nomination for Maine Teacher of the Year (2015) and the Governor's "Points of Light" Award (2002). I have contributed to professional development in curriculum, assessment, educational technology, social-emotional learning, and leadership, including presentations at state and district conferences. My teaching over the past 14 years has been local within RSU 21 and RSU 57. My high standards of reaching any learner with multiple modalities, compassion and enjoyment is my focus.
